Hybrid Fitness Models: Bridging Physical and Digital Realms

Gone are the days when you had to choose between in-person and online fitness. The trend toward hybrid fitness models is set to become a dominant force by 2025. Blending physical spaces with digital platforms offers a unique opportunity for users to experience the best of both worlds. Fitness On Demand is leading the way in helping fitness businesses adopt this approach.

How Hybrid Fitness Works

With the hybrid model:

  • Gyms can offer on-site group classes while simultaneously streaming them to clients exercising from home.
  • Users have access to a combination of live and pre-recorded workouts tailored to their needs.
  • Businesses can expand their reach beyond geographical limits, serving a global audience.

The Rise of Mind-Body Wellness

As the world continues to prioritize mental health, mind-body wellness is becoming a cornerstone of fitness trends. By 2025, we’ll see a surge in demand for workouts that combine physical activity with mental clarity. Expect to see growth in programs focused on:

  • Yoga and Meditation: A staple of well-being, these practices promote relaxation and stress reduction.
  • Breathwork: Designed to improve physical and emotional resilience through conscious breathing techniques.
  • Holistic Recovery: Emphasis on rest, mobility, and mindfulness to complement high-intensity training routines.
